Why is understanding fear important for Christians?

Answered in 2 sources

Understanding fear helps Christians to recognize the difference between the healthy reverence for God and the paralyzing fear that is cast out by love.

For Christians, understanding fear is crucial as it delineates a healthy fear of God, which is reverence and awe, from a fear that is incapacitating and rooted in guilt. The biblical narrative frequently addresses fear, showing that while fear of the Lord is the beginning of wisdom (Proverbs 9:10), the kind of fear that paralyzes is not from God. 2 Timothy 1:7 reminds believers that God has not given us a spirit of fear, but of power, love, and a sound mind. This distinction is important for Christians because it emphasizes that true security and boldness in faith come from understanding God's perfect love which casts out all fear, leading to a life of faith rather than fear.
